5-Day Budget Adventure and Culinary Immersion in New Orleans
Viewed by 61 travelers
Save This Itinerary
Share
Day 1: Culture and Cuisine
New Orleans, USA
8:00AM
Breakfast at Café du Monde
Start your day with a classic beignet and café au lait at this iconic French Quarter café, a must-try New Orleans experience.
Walk to Café du Monde from your accommodation in the French Quarter.
USD5, 1 hour
9:30AM
French Quarter Walking Tour
Join a guided tour to immerse yourself in the vibrant history, architecture, and culture of the French Quarter.
The tour starts at Jackson Square, a short walk from Café du Monde.
USD20, 2 hours
12:00PM
Lunch at Coop's Place
Enjoy some authentic Cajun cuisine with their famous rabbit and sausage jambalaya in this local hangout.
A 10-minute walk from Jackson Square.
USD15, 1 hour
1:30PM
Explore the Historic Garden District
Stroll through the picturesque streets and take in the stunning antebellum mansions.
Take the St. Charles Streetcar from downtown to the Garden District (USD1.25 fare).
USD2.50, 2 hours
4:00PM
Visit the Lafayette Cemetery No. 1
Explore this famous above-ground cemetery, full of intricate tombs and rich history.
It's just a short walk from the Garden District.
Free, 1 hour
5:30PM
Dinner at Dat Dog
Try creative hot dogs with a variety of toppings in a vibrant atmosphere.
Take the St. Charles Streetcar back downtown (USD1.25 fare).
USD10, 1 hour
7:00PM
Live Jazz at Preservation Hall
Catch a live performance at this revered venue that celebrates New Orleans' jazz heritage.
It's located in the French Quarter, a short walk from Dat Dog.
USD20 (entry fee), 1.5 hours

Day 2: Art and Folklore
New Orleans, USA
8:00AM
Breakfast at Willa Jean
Start your day with their delicious breakfast biscuits and rich coffee.
Take a 10-minute walk from your accommodation.
USD12, 1 hour
9:30AM
National WWII Museum
Experience one of the most impressive museums with deeply immersive exhibitions showcasing history.
Take the streetcar to Lee Circle (USD1.25 fare) and walk to the museum.
USD30, 3 hours
12:30PM
Lunch at the Green Goddess
Enjoy a fresh and unique menu with local ingredients in a charming setting.
Walk 5 minutes from the National WWII Museum.
USD15, 1 hour
1:30PM
Exploration of the Frenchmen Street
Wander through the local art galleries and shops, and check out street performances.
Take the streetcar or a 15-minute walk.
Free, 2 hours
3:30PM
Visit the Music Club Scene
Explore some live music venues like Blue Nile or The Spotted Cat for an afternoon fix of local tunes.
They are located on Frenchmen Street.
Free (unless you buy drinks), 2 hours
5:30PM
Dinner at Lil’ Dizzy’s Café
Savor delicious fried chicken and Southern sides in a cozy atmosphere.
Walk 10 minutes from the music venues.
USD15, 1 hour
7:00PM
Evening Ghost Tour
Engage in a spooky walking tour of haunted places in the French Quarter.
Departure point is near Jackson Square, about 10 minutes walk from Lil’ Dizzy’s.
USD25, 2 hours

Day 3: Historical Insights
New Orleans, USA
8:00AM
Breakfast at Mother’s Restaurant
Indulge in a hearty Louisiana breakfast featuring their famous Ferdi special po-boy.
A quick 5-minute walk from your accommodation.
USD10, 1 hour
9:30AM
Visit the Historic Voodoo Museum
Learn about the fascinating history of Voodoo and its influence on Louisiana culture.
A short walk from Mother’s Restaurant.
USD10, 1.5 hours
11:00AM
Tour of the Cabildo
Discover New Orleans’ history in this museum which formerly served as the seat of government.
Walk 10 minutes.
USD10, 1.5 hours
12:30PM
Lunch at Crescent City Brewhouse
Enjoy a classic NOLA meal with their famous red beans and rice, paired with a local draft.
A 10-minute walk from the Cabildo.
USD20, 1 hour
2:00PM
Stroll through Jackson Square
Take a leisurely stroll, enjoying street performers and local art as you soak in the ambiance.
Located next to your lunch spot.
Free, 2 hours
4:00PM
Visit the New Orleans Museum of Art
Explore incredible art collections within City Park, including both traditional and contemporary works.
Take a 15-minute streetcar ride (USD1.25 fare) from downtown.
USD15, 2 hours
6:30PM
Dinner at Jacques-Imo's Cafe
Dine on creative Cajun-Creole fusion dishes in an eclectic, lively restaurant.
Take a streetcar back downtown and then a 5-minute walk.
USD25, 1 hour
8:00PM
Live Music at Tipitina's
Experience a classic New Orleans venue with authentic local music, and perhaps dance along!
About a 15-minute taxi or rideshare ride from Jacques-Imo's.
USD10 (entry fee), 2.5 hours

Day 4: Cuisine Delight
New Orleans, USA
8:00AM
Breakfast at Café Beignet
Savor delicious beignet and chicory coffee in a quaint café atmosphere.
A 5-minute walk from your accommodation.
USD8, 1 hour
9:30AM
Cooking Class: Taste Buds Kitchen
Participate in a hands-on cooking class to learn about Cajun cooking techniques and recipes.
It's located a short distance from the French Quarter.
USD75 (for class), 3.5 hours
1:00PM
Lunch at Domilise's Po-Boy & Bar
Savor the best po-boy sandwiches around, famous for their shrimp and roast beef.
Take a streetcar to the nearby area (USD1.25 fare).
USD12, 1 hour
2:30PM
Visit the Historic Ursuline Convent
Explore one of the oldest historic buildings in the city, rich in history and architecture.
Backtrack by streetcar to the French Quarter (USD1.25 fare).
Free, 1 hour
3:30PM
Explore Royal Street Art Galleries
Wander through charming streets lined with art galleries showcasing local artists.
Easy walking distance from the Ursuline Convent.
Free, 1 hour
4:30PM
Relax at The Spotted Cat Music Club
Enjoy live music in a cozy atmosphere while sipping a drink and resting your feet.
Located close by on Frenchmen Street.
Free (unless you buy drinks), 1.5 hours
6:30PM
Dinner at Emeril's Delmonico
Indulge in upscale dining with a taste of the classic Creole dishes reimagined by a celebrity chef.
Take a streetcar (USD1.25) back to the CBD.
USD40, 1.5 hours
8:00PM
Live Performance at the Saenger Theatre
Catch a fantastic performance something local or national at this historic theater.
It's a short streetcar ride from dinner (USD1.25 fare).
USD30 (ticket price), 2 hours

Day 5: Farewell NOLA
New Orleans, USA
9:00AM
Brunch at Elizabeth's Restaurant
Delight in a Southern brunch featuring their famous praline bacon.
Take a short taxi or rideshare to Bywater.
USD15, 1.5 hours
10:30AM
Visit to the New Orleans Historic Voodoo Museum
Explore the mystical world of voodoo culture and its place in New Orleans history.
Take a rideshare or taxi back to the French Quarter.
USD10, 1.5 hours
12:00PM
Explore the French Market
Take in the unique local shopping and delicious food stalls at this historic market.
A short walk from the Voodoo Museum.
Free (unless you buy something), 2 hours
2:00PM
Lunch at Central Grocery
Grab a muffuletta sandwich from this iconic deli known for its delicious flavors.
A quick walk to the deli.
USD10, 1 hour
3:30PM
Explore Saint Louis Cathedral
Visit this stunning cathedral, the oldest continuously active Roman Catholic cathedral in the US.
It’s located in Jackson Square, easily accessible.
Free, 1 hour
5:00PM
Dinner at Cafe Amelie
Conclude your trip with a refreshing dinner in a hidden courtyard featuring delightful Southern dishes.
Just a short walk from Jackson Square.
USD25, 1.5 hours
7:00PM
Live Music or Dance at Frenchmen Street
Spend your last night soaking in the vibrant music scene with a lively atmosphere.
Take a stroll to Frenchmen Street for a night of celebration.
Free (unless you buy drinks), 2 hours
